Mario Urrutia
Mario Urrutia is a magistrate of the Tribunal de Justicia Electoral (TJE) in Honduras, known for his involvement in overseeing electoral processes and ensuring the integrity of election results. He has played a significant role in addressing electoral disputes and maintaining transparency in the voting process, particularly in contentious areas like La Lima, Cortés.
